Solution

Diagnosing an engine misfire on an Audi A6 C7 (2011-2018) involves several steps to pinpoint the root cause. Engine misfires can result from ignition system issues, fuel delivery problems, or mechanical failures. Here’s a detailed guide to help you through the diagnosis and repair process.

Step 1: Retrieve Diagnostic Trouble Codes (DTCs)

  1. Tools Required: OBD-II Scanner
  2. Procedure:
    • Connect the OBD-II scanner to the vehicle’s diagnostic port.
    • Turn the ignition to the "ON" position without starting the engine.
    • Retrieve any stored codes related to misfires, such as P0300 (random misfire) or P0301-P0306 (cylinder-specific misfires).
    • Note any other relevant codes that might indicate issues with fuel pressure, ignition, or air intake.

Step 2: Visual Inspection

  1. Tools Required: Flashlight, Inspection Mirror
  2. Procedure:
    • Inspect ignition coils and spark plugs for signs of wear or damage.
    • Check for loose or damaged vacuum hoses, which can cause vacuum leaks and misfires.
    • Look for any signs of oil or coolant leaks around the engine, which could affect ignition components.

Step 3: Inspect Ignition Components

  1. Tools Required: Multimeter, Spark Plug Socket
  2. Procedure:
    • Remove and inspect spark plugs. Look for fouling, wear, or incorrect gaps. Replace if necessary.
    • Test ignition coils using a multimeter to check resistance and continuity.
    • Swap ignition coils between cylinders to see if the misfire follows a specific coil.

Step 4: Check Fuel System

  1. Tools Required: Fuel Pressure Gauge
  2. Procedure:
    • Connect a fuel pressure gauge to the fuel rail.
    • Compare the reading with the manufacturer’s specifications.
    • Inspect fuel injectors for clogging or malfunction. Use a stethoscope to listen for injector operation.

Step 5: Compression Test

  1. Tools Required: Compression Tester
  2. Procedure:
    • Remove spark plugs and insert the compression tester into each cylinder.
    • Crank the engine and record the compression readings.
    • Compare the readings with specifications to identify any weak cylinders.

Step 6: Additional Checks

  • Check for Exhaust Leaks: Small leaks can affect oxygen sensor readings and cause misfires.
  • Examine PCV System: Ensure the PCV valve and related hoses are functioning correctly.

Repair Instructions

Ignition System Repairs

  1. Replace Spark Plugs: If plugs are worn or fouled, replace them with the recommended type and gap them according to specifications.
  2. Replace Faulty Ignition Coils: If a coil is defective, replace it. It’s often wise to replace all coils if one has failed, especially on high-mileage vehicles.

Fuel System Repairs

  1. Clean or Replace Fuel Injectors: If injectors are clogged, consider using a fuel injector cleaner or replace them if necessary.
  2. Repair Fuel Pressure Issues: Replace the fuel pump or pressure regulator if the pressure is not within specifications.

Mechanical Repairs

  1. Repair Internal Engine Issues: If low compression is found, further investigate for possible causes like worn piston rings, damaged valves, or head gasket issues.

Conclusion

After performing the necessary repairs, clear the DTCs, and test drive the vehicle to ensure the issue is resolved. If the misfire persists, further investigation into the engine control system or mechanical components may be required. Always refer to the Audi A6 service manual for specific torque specifications and repair procedures.
